What is Direct Cremation?

Direct cremation is a streamlined cremation process where the body is cremated soon after passing, without a viewing or formal service beforehand.

How It Differs From Traditional Funeral Services

  • No embalming or cosmetic preparations – The body is cremated in its natural state.
  • No public viewing or wake – Families can hold a private memorial later.
  • Basic cremation container instead of a casket – Reduces costs and waste.
  • Ashes are returned to the family – Loved ones choose how and when to honor their deceased.

For families looking for a simple cremation process, this option provides a respectful farewell without the pressures of immediate event planning.


Why Direct Cremation is the Preferred Option in Maryland

Many Maryland families find direct cremation to be a compassionate, practical, and financially responsible choice.

1. Lower Cost Compared to Traditional Burials

Traditional funerals in Maryland range from $7,000 to $12,000, while direct cremation costs between $1,000 and $3,000.

Direct cremation is more affordable because:

  • No embalming, hearse, or gravesite purchase
  • No requirement for expensive caskets or vaults
  • Lower service and facility fees

These financial advantages make direct cremation an appealing alternative for those seeking affordable cremation services without sacrificing dignity.

How Direct Cremation Works in Maryland

The cremation process involves a few essential steps:

  1. Choosing a Cremation Provider – Families select a licensed provider in Maryland, often finalizing details online or by phone.
  2. Paperwork and Authorization – The provider handles death certificates, permits, and state-required documents.
  3. Transportation to the Crematory – The deceased is respectfully transferred to the facility.
  4. Cremation Process – The body is placed in a cremation chamber, a process that typically takes a few hours.
  5. Return of Ashes – Families receive the ashes in a selected urn or temporary container.

This efficient process allows families to focus on their personal memorial plans.
